Online Therapy Platforms

Online therapy platforms provide the benefit of accessing therapy from the comfort of your own house. They are ideal for people who reside in remote areas, have mobility issues, or just choose the convenience of online therapy. Here’s how BetterHelp compares to other online treatment platforms.

BetterHelp vs. Talkspace

Talkspace is another popular online treatment platform. Both Talkspace and BetterHelp provide similar services, consisting of individual and couples therapy. There are some key differences between the two platforms. BetterHelp has a larger network of therapists, which indicates that customers have a better chance of discovering a therapist who is a good fit for them. In addition, BetterHelp uses more economical prices strategies compared to Talkspace. Nevertheless, Talkspace uses a free consultation, which BetterHelp does not.

BetterHelp vs. BetterUp

BetterUp is an online training and counseling platform that focuses on personal and professional advancement. While BetterUp provides coaching services, it does not offer therapy services like BetterHelp. BetterUp is perfect for people who want to focus on individual growth and career advancement rather than mental health concerns.

BetterHelp vs. Amwell

Amwell is an online health care platform that uses telemedicine services, including psychological health services. Amwell’s psychological health services are provided by licensed therapists, but the platform does not specialize in psychological health like BetterHelp does. In addition, Amwell’s mental health services are just offered in specific states, while BetterHelp is available nationwide.

Seeing a therapist can have many benefits for a person’s psychological health and wellness. Here are some of the advantages of seeing a therapist from a psychological point of view:

Increased self-awareness
One of the primary advantages of seeing a therapist is increased self-awareness. A therapist can assist you identify patterns in your feelings, ideas, and habits, along with the underlying beliefs and worths that drive them. By becoming more knowledgeable about these patterns, you can acquire a much deeper understanding of yourself and your inspirations, which can cause personal development and advancement.

Enhanced psychological policy
Emotional guideline is the capability to manage and manage one’s emotions in an adaptive and healthy way. Seeing a therapist can assist people learn and practice emotional policy strategies, such as deep breathing and mindfulness, that can be useful in managing challenging emotions and decreasing stress.

Better interpersonal relationships
Interpersonal relationships are a vital component of psychological health and wellness.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als improve their interaction skills, assertiveness, and compassion, which can cause much healthier and more satisfying relationships with others.

Increased problem-solving abilities
Therapy can also help individuals establish problem-solving abilities. By working with a therapist, individuals can find out to approach issues in a more systematic and reliable method, determine prospective options, and make decisions that are lined up with their worths and objectives.

Enhanced self-esteem
Self-esteem refers to an individual’s sense of self-respect and value.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als recognize and challenge negative self-talk and beliefs that can add to low self-esteem. Through treatment, individuals can discover to establish a more reasonable and favorable self-image, which can result in increased confidence and self-worth.

Enhanced coping abilities
Coping abilities are methods and methods that individuals utilize to handle stress and difficulty. Seeing a therapist can help people develop and practice coping skills that are customized to their specific requirements and choices. Coping abilities can consist of mindfulness, relaxation techniques, analytical, and social assistance, to name a few.

Minimized symptoms of mental illness
Therapy can likewise be effective in decreasing symptoms of mental illness, such as anxiety, anxiety, and trauma (PTSD). Therapists utilize evidence-based treatments, such as cognitive-behavioral treatment (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), and eye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R), to help individuals manage signs and improve their total lifestyle.

In conclusion, seeing a therapist can have many advantages for an individual’s psychological health and health and wellbeing. By increasing self-awareness, enhancing emotional policy, improving social relationships, establishing analytical abilities, enhancing self-esteem, improving coping skills, and lowering signs of mental disorder, therapy can be a reliable tool for individual development and development.
